From: Hirano bodies differentially modulate cell death induced by tau and the amyloid precursor protein intracellular domain

Model Hirano bodies differentially influence cell death in the presence of GSK3β (S9A) and tau. H4 cells were transiently transfected with equal amounts of plasmid DNA. Control cells (white bars) were transfected with plasmid encoding either GFP or model Hirano bodies (CT-GFP) in the presence or absence of constitutively active GSK3β (S9A). Cells were transfected with plasmid encoding GSK3β (S9A), a single tau variant, and either GFP (black bars) or model Hirano bodies (check bars). A. Tau variants 352WT, 441WT, or 352PHP. B. Tau variants R5H, G272V, P301l, or R406W. C. Tau variants K18 or K18ΔK280. D. Tau variants 441WT or P301L transfected with a lower amount of plasmid encoding GSK3β (S9A). Model Hirano bodies significantly promote cell death induced by GSK3β (S9A) and tau except in tau mutants R5H, R406W, K18, and K18ΔK280, where they have no effect. *p < 0.05, **p < 0.01, ***p < 0.001. Error bars represent the standard deviation.
